Every release artifact is produced by the hermetic pipeline on the Corvidge build farm; no locally built binaries are ever promoted. Provenance records capture the source revision, toolchain image, and dependency lockfile digest, and are signed at promotion time. If you are on call and need to verify that a deployed simulator matches its declared source, compare the signed record against the artifact. The canonical build token for the current release appears below.

build token for bahip-fawif: htk3_6a1

Handover Note — Warranty Cost Overrun

To my successor:

The most pressing item you inherit is the warranty overrun on the Ferrowell HX pump line. Claims are running 38% above provision, driven mainly by seal failures in units built at the Granthaven plant between March and July. I've commissioned a root-cause review, expected back in four weeks, and negotiated extended terms with the seal supplier, Ardale Components. Reserve adjustments are drafted but not booked. Please read the confidential business-plan note appended immediately below.

board note of bawep-tajef: Queniusek Systems plans to raise the Quenvan list price by 53.1 percent in March. The pricing group signed off on a budget of $176.4 million for Project Drueth. The renewal with Casionix Partners closes at $142.5 million a year, 8.3 percent below the last contract. Project Fraax slips by six weeks because of the tooling delay.

Build Provenance — ContrastGate Audit

The ContrastGate accessibility audit runs in a hermetic builder; every color-contrast report is tied to the exact ruleset commit and token palette snapshot used. On-call: if a report's findings look inconsistent with production styling, first verify the palette snapshot matches the deployed theme bundle before reopening issues. Reports lacking a provenance stamp are invalid — discard and re-trigger the audit job. Each signed report embeds its ruleset hash and the identifier shown below.

session token of taduf-tahog = htk4_91a1